Description of 🧀 Premium Black Nylon Gloves with Polyurethane Coated Palm - Large Size (12 Pair/Pkg) by Global Glove PUG-17-L

EN 388 levels: 4131. ANSI/ESD SP15. 1-2005 compliant & ANSI/ESD S20. 20-2007 compliant. 13 gauge nylon shell offers bare hand sensitivity. Polyurethane dip provides superior grip and comfort. Knit wrist cuff prevents gloves from slipping off during use.

I am an electrician and use these to keep my hands clean and prevent minor cuts and abrasions. I buy a size smaller so they are tight so I can accommodate small screws etc. When I'm pulling a cord or running a line, they last about a week before a hole appears in them, and when I'm doing simpler tasks, they last longer. Generally a small price for the cleanliness and safety of the hands :-))

Almost perfect for home decoration

These are the best work gloves I have found. They are very thin, which gives great dexterity. I can print to my computer or portable scanner without removing them. Despite being so thin, they are durable. I have enough steam to work in the warehouse Monday to Friday for a month, processing wood and lifting windows. The cost of these gloves is great, just over a dollar for a pair. They just don't keep fingers warm outside in the winter or in the fridge.

Good glove for safety work

I bought these gloves after using similar ones in a big shop, they were good but a bit expensive. They are equal or better than the previous ones and last me about 1-2 months if I use them daily for school safety tasks like disposing, sweeping, dusting and mopping. They are not waterproof, so use in wet areas is not recommended. While they protect your hands, they also seem to wick away moisture and result in dry hands during the cold winter months.
